# Hysterectomy Informed Consent > **Important — not medical advice.** For use by a licensed provider; tailor to the patient, your protocols, and state law. **Patient Name:** ___________ **Date of Birth:** ___________ **Medical Record Number:** ___________ **Ordering Provider:** ___________ **Planned Procedure Date:** ___________ --- ## NOTICE: LOSS OF FERTILITY **Hysterectomy involves the surgical removal of the uterus. After this procedure, you will no longer be able to become pregnant or carry a pregnancy. This is permanent. You should consider this decision carefully if you have any desire for future pregnancy.** --- ## 1. Procedure I, the undersigned patient, consent to hysterectomy performed by my healthcare provider. **Extent of surgery planned:** ___________ **Ovaries and tubes:** ___________ **Surgical approach:** ___________ Hysterectomy removes the uterus (and the cervix if total). The procedure is performed in the operating room under general or regional anesthesia. The surgical approach (abdominal, vaginal, laparoscopic, or robotic) is selected based on uterine size, pathology, prior surgeries, body habitus, and surgical expertise. --- ## 2. Indication **Clinical indication (e.g., uterine fibroids, endometriosis, adenomyosis, pelvic organ prolapse, abnormal uterine bleeding, gynecologic malignancy, obstetric hemorrhage):** ___________
